The naira recovered from a two-day loss on Tuesday, March 24, 2026, appreciating to N1,382.63 against the United States dollar at the official market.
Data released by the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) showed that the naira gained N5.75.
This represents a 0.4 per cent increase compared to Monday, when the local currency traded at N1,388.38 to the dollar following resumption from the Sallah break.
